titleOfInvention Integral color diffusion transfer element for large volume development
abstract In accordance with this invention a photographic color diffusion transfer element is provided wherein said element comprises a single dimensionally stable transparent support and coated thereon in reactive association and in sequence (1) a mordant layer for binding diffusible dyes, (2) a light reflecting layer, (3) imaging layers comprising a radiation sensitive layer comprising silver halide and a diffusible dye forming layer comprising a diffusible dye forming compound, and (4) a barrier layer comprising a polymer that allows the passage of solutions for processing said element when said element is contacted with an external processing bath, and wherein said barrier layer impedes the diffusion out of said element of the diffusible dye formed from said diffusible dye forming compound. In another preferred embodiment, the sequential arrangement of layers next to the support is in the order: (1) imaging layers comprising a radiation sensitive layer comprising silver halide and a diffusible dye forming layer comprising a diffusible dye forming compound, ( 2) a light reflecting layer, (3) a mordant layer for binding diffusible dyes, (4) a barrier layer comprising a polymer that allows the passage of solutions for processing said element when said element is contacted with an external processing bath, and wherein said barrier layer impedes the diffusion out of said element of the diffusible dye formed from said diffusible dye forming compound.
